Services to Support Social Participation

Engaging you with social activities and events

We support you in enjoying your favourite activities by connecting you with local programs and organisations that offer diverse opportunities for socialising and community participation. These may include:

  • Recreation, gym access, and sports
  • Training and education
  • Social events and group meet-ups
  • Arts and crafts
  • Attending movies, concerts, or sports games
  • Employment preparation
  • Library and local hub services
  • Family events and personal appointments

Our goal is to make community participation easier and more accessible, reducing stress and enabling you to engage more frequently in the activities you love.
